First performed in the early 1600s, The Tragedy of Macbeth finds its way to the big screen once again with it’s most star studded cast yet. The Tragedy of Macbeth (2021) stars Denzel Washington, Frances McDormand, Alex Hassell, Bertie Carvel, and Corey Hawkins in what the Pee Bagz describe as the best film adaptation to watch in English class yet.
